2015 Global Terrorism Index: Deaths From Terrorism Increased 80% Last Year to the Highest Level Ever; Global Economic Cost of Terrorism Reached All-Time High at US$52.9 Billion


LONDON, Nov. 17, 2015 /PRNewswire/ --

32,658 people were killed by terrorism in 2014 compared to 18,111 in 2013: the largest increase ever recorded

Boko Haram and ISIL were jointly responsible for 51% of all claimed global fatalities in 2014

Boko Haram has overtaken ISIL as world's deadliest terrorist group

Countries suffering over 500 deaths increased by 120% to 11 countries

78% of all deaths and 57% of all attacks occurred in just five countries: Afghanistan, Iraq, Nigeria, Pakistan and Syria

Iraq continues to be the country most impacted by terrorism with 9,929 terrorist fatalities the highest ever recorded in a single country

Nigeria experienced the largest increase in terrorist activity with 7,512 deaths in 2014, an increase of over 300% since 2013
